Output 52284399c35eb4b6172f3c7b461cb488c4bd61dd2a7ad2c93173e5fd0faeb6f1:0

value
497669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b00e0390d251287d03570d1fd325af9b551b740a OP_EQUAL
address
3Hjue1aMv1bLWyNdCS8B2DF2FcUCu7whrK
transaction
52284399c35eb4b6172f3c7b461cb488c4bd61dd2a7ad2c93173e5fd0faeb6f1
spent
true